Bent Press

The bent press is a unilateral urgent variation made well-known by power pioneers Eugen Sandow, Arthur Saxon, and Louis Cyr within the nineteenth century. This train trains your physique to deal with heavy weights overhead. Consider it as a standing Turkish get-up on steroids.

The right way to do it

  1. Clear the kettlebell to the rack place and rotate the foot reverse to the kettlebell at about 45 levels.
  2. Press your higher arm into your lat, rotate the arm away out of your chest, and rotate your torso along with your arm. Take into consideration resting the working elbow in your hip.
  3. Then twist your torso towards the entrance whereas the kettlebell strikes behind you. Really feel the load switch to your legs. Relaxation the other arm in your thigh.
  4. Whereas trying towards the kettlebell, lockout out your elbow and get beneath it.
  5. After the arm is prolonged, get up.
  6. Reverse the motion rigorously and reset and repeat

*Notice: This may be carried out with quite a lot of tools, together with dumbbells and kettlebells (proven right here).

The way it helps: The bent press improves thoracic mobility and shoulder power, which has a direct carryover to overhead power and any sport or exercise that calls for torso rotation.

Units & Reps: Three to 5 units of three to five reps on either side early in your coaching.

 

Kirk Shrugs

This train bought its identify from the lifter who first used them, powerlifting champion Kirk Karwoski. He and his coach Marty Gallagher developed this to enhance Kirk’s grip power, however each quickly realized it put slabs of muscle on the higher traps. As a facet profit, it helped crush his deadlift power numbers.

The right way to do it:

  1. Place the barbell at thigh stage in a squat rack.
  2. Grip utilizing a thumbless overhand grip.
  3. Shrug the load by solely utilizing your traps and lats and pause for a second if you get to your stomach button
  4. Slowly decrease the barbell right down to the beginning place and reset and repeat.

The way it helps: If you wish to develop a giant yoke, that is the train for you. Plus, growing higher again power and muscle helps hold the barbell near you when your deadlift and supplies a ‘shelf’ for barbell squats.   

Units & Reps: Carry out three to 4 units of 8 to 12 reps and the top of an higher physique session, or select a weight round 30-40% of your 1RM deadlift and do AMRAP.

 

Pendlay Row

The Pendlay row is called after former coach Glenn Pendlay, who misplaced his battle with most cancers a number of years again. Pendlay noticed a flaw within the bent-over row, and this was his means of fixing it. He got here up with this row variation that begins each repetition from a lifeless cease to extend maximal again power and explosiveness in your deadlift.

The right way to do it:

  1. Arrange as you’d for a standard deadlift.
  2. Hinge and grip the barbell with an overhand shoulder-width grip.
  3. Squeeze your armpits collectively, and produce your chest as much as get your again impartial.
  4. Then, explosively pull the barbell in the direction of your sternum.
  5. Return the barbell to the ground and reset and repeat.

The way it helps: Spending time within the hinge place wonders on your decrease again power and endurance. If deadlifting slowly from the ground is your weak point, the Pendlay row’s explosive nature will assist.

Units & Reps: This row variation is finest carried out for power and energy, so performing  three to 5 units of between 4 to eight reps works nicely.

 

JM Press

When JM Blakey skilled at Westside Barbell and was crushing EVERY bench press document in sight, those that skilled with him observed he was performing a carry they’d by no means seen earlier than. It was a hybrid transfer, half close-grip bench press, half cranium crusher, and complete triceps builder. And once they did it, they cherished it, and the JM Press was born.

The right way to do it

  1. Begin the train the identical means because the shut grip bench press, besides make sure the barbell is immediately above the higher chest. Think about working a line from the barbell right down to the higher pecs.
  2. Use a slender grip of round 16 inches aside.
  3. The elbows are 45 levels from the physique and are stored up your entire time.
  4. As you deliver the barbell in the direction of you, cock the wrist to carry the bar in place.
  5. Decrease the bar down till your forearm touches your bicep.  Let the bar roll again about one inch to maintain the elbows pointed ahead and up. Then press the bar again up.

The way it helps: JM presses deal with lockout triceps power that transfers on to your bench and overhead press. Because of the shorter ROM, you’ll additionally go heavier than your normal triceps extension variation.

Units & Reps: Three to 5 units of 4 to six reps for power or two to a few units of 8 to 12 for muscle.

 

Snatch-grip Deadlift

The snatch grip deadlift derives its identify from the Olympic carry as a result of it resembles the primary a part of the snatch motion. The broader grip places a big demand on the higher again muscle tissues as a result of they work more durable to maintain the backbone impartial.  Plus, this helps enhance your grip power as a result of your arms are away from the shoulders.

The right way to do it:

  1. Get your toes beneath the barbell with a wider stance than typical and angle your toes barely.
  2. Hinge down, assume a snatch grip, and make sure the arms are making full contact with the barbell. You could must bend your knees a bit to decrease your hips.
  3. Squeeze your armpits, get your chest up and drive your toes by way of the ground.
  4. End along with your glutes at lockout, decrease to the ground, reset, and repeat.

The way it helps: IMO, you can’t get sufficient higher again power for the deadlift or any train, and this deadlift variation checks this to the max. This variation places the hips in a decrease place, and extra oomph is required for the preliminary pull, making it a safer choice than deficit deadlifts for some lifters.

Units & Reps: Carry out these in the event you’re sluggish off the ground, want to enhance your grip power, or are on the lookout for a bit selection. Three to 5 units of three to six reps work nicely.
